Real Madrid is the next assignment for 28-year-old David Kramer

By Johnny Askounis/ info@eurohoops.net

David Kramer inked a one-year contract to join Real Madrid.

Following successful medicals, his addition to the 2025-26 roster was announced on Friday.

Per the press release: Real Madrid C.F. has reached an agreement with David Krämer, small forward from La Laguna Tenerife, whereby the player will remain at the club for the next season, until 30 June 2026.

David Krämer was crowned world champion with the German national team at the 2023 World Cup, held in Japan, Indonesia and the Philippines.

Following his arrival at Real Madrid, Krämer will embark on his third season in Spain, after playing for Covirán Granada and La Laguna Tenerife.”

The 28-year-old shooting guard returns to the EuroLeague, following six appearances with FC Bayern Munich during the 2020-21 season.

Last season with La Laguna Tenerife in the Basketball Champions League, he tallied 12.0 points, 1.9 rebounds, 0.9 assists, 0.8 steals, and 0.1 blocks per game over 15 appearances, stretching to the Final Four powered by Sunel. Making his way to 37 fixtures of Spain’s Liga Endesa, he put up 11.1 points, 2.0 rebounds, 0.8 steals, 0.7 assists, and 0.1 blocks per contest.

Beyond his club career, Kramer currently represents Germany after debuting at the junior level with Austria in 2013. In addition to winning gold in the FIBA World Cup 2023, he has also suited up for the senior national team in the Qualifiers of the 2019 and 2023 editions of the World Cup, and the Qualifiers of the EuroBasket 2025.
